Q: How do I restore access to the Brindlecore firmware update channel?

A: Channel pushes go through the Oxtail signing relay. If the relay account expires, do not re-provision. Recover the existing account instead; device fleets pin its identity. Open the relay console, select recover, and confirm the channel ID. The console then asks for the passphrase kept on file below.

unlock words, hahip-yagef: zorok-novmir-zorix-silax

Subject: Quickstore 4.2 — bloom filter now fronts the KV layer

Plugin authors: starting with this release, Quickstore places a bloom filter ahead of the key-value store. Negative lookups return faster; false positives fall through safely. No API changes are required on your side. Verify your plugin against the staging build referenced below.

session token of fahif-tadup = htk3_9c7

# Varnix Encoding Sniffer — env config
# Uploaded text files pass through the charset detection stage before
# parsing. ENCODING_SAMPLE_BYTES caps how much of each file we read for
# detection (default 8192). If confidence falls below ENCODING_MIN_SCORE,
# the file is quarantined rather than coerced to UTF-8, which is the
# behavior reviewers asked us to preserve after the Tillbrook audit.
# Detection results are logged without file contents. The quarantine
# service requires authentication, and its token is set on the following line.

secret setting of hawep-yahig: LEDGER_TOKEN29=41b5d6315371c92885eaeb077fb63

## Deployment

Shipping a new build of the Striderline chip reader is low-drama if you follow the order: flash the reader firmware first, then update the gateway daemon on the finish-line box, then restart the sync agent. Doing it backwards leaves the gateway rejecting chip pings for a few minutes, which panics race directors. Always deploy at least two days before an event — no race-morning heroics, please. The gateway daemon expects the following configuration.

settings of fawip-yadug:
[druath]
port = 3000
region = north-4
host = druath.qirvanworks.corp
timeout_ms = 1500
retries = 1